Choosing the perfect carnival swing ride for sale for your event involves several key considerations to ensure it meets your needs and enhances the overall experience. Here’s a guide to help you make the right choice:

 

Determine Your Space Requirements:

 

Size and Capacity: Assess the available space at your event venue. Ensure the swing chair  ride fits comfortably within the space, allowing for safe operation and sufficient room for visitors to enjoy the ride.

Footprint: Check the ride’s dimensions and ensure there is enough space for installation, operation, and emergency access.

 

Consider the Target Audience:

 

Age Group: Choose a swing ride that caters to the age range of your attendees. Some rides are designed for younger children, while others may be more suitable for teens and adults.

Height and Weight Restrictions: Ensure the ride’s height and weight limits align with the demographics of your event attendees.

Evaluate Safety Features:

 

Safety Standards: Verify that the ride complies with local safety regulations and standards. Look for features like secure restraints, non-slip surfaces, and emergency stop mechanisms.

Maintenance Requirements: Choose a ride with a good safety track record and easy maintenance procedures to ensure amusement park swing carousel remains in excellent condition throughout the event.

 

Budget Considerations:

 

Cost: Compare the costs of different swing rides, including purchase or rental prices, setup, and operational expenses. Ensure the ride fits within your event budget while offering good value.

Insurance: Factor in the cost of insurance coverage for the ride, which may be necessary for liability and safety purposes.

 

Check for Customization Options:

 

Design and Theme: Consider whether the ride can be customized to match your event’s theme or branding. Customization options may include colors, lighting, and decorations.

Special Features: Some rides come with additional features such as music or interactive elements. Determine if these enhancements will add value to your event.

 

Assess Operational and Setup Needs:

 

Installation: Review the installation requirements and ensure you have the necessary resources and expertise to set up the ride.

Operational Support: Check if the ride comes with operational support, such as trained staff or technical assistance, to ensure smooth operation during the event.

Review Manufacturer and Supplier Reputation:

 

Quality and Reliability: Research the manufacturer’s reputation and read reviews from other clients. Choose a reliable supplier known for delivering high-quality and well-maintained equipment. For example, FRP material, stainless steel material, etc.

Customer Service: Ensure the supplier offers good customer service, including support for any issues that may arise before, during, or after the event.

 

Consider Logistics and Transportation:

 

Delivery: Confirm the logistics of transporting the ride to and from the event location. Ensure the supplier can handle delivery and setup efficiently.

Storage: Plan for storage if the ride will be used for multiple events or needs to be stored between uses.
